Streeter's North Dakota climate presents significant challenges, including heavy winter snow loads, high winds, and large temperature swings. For durability, we strongly recommend impact-resistant asphalt shingles (Class 4 rated) or metal roofing, which excel at shedding snow and resisting wind uplift. Regular inspections in spring and fall are crucial to check for damage from ice dams in winter and hail from summer storms common to the region.
For a standard single-family home in Streeter, a full roof replacement typically ranges from $8,500 to $15,000. Key cost factors include the steepness and complexity of your roof, the material chosen (with asphalt shingles being most common), and the cost of removing/disposing of the old roof. Prices can also be influenced by the need for enhanced ice and water shield protection at the eaves—a critical upgrade for our snowy winters—and current regional material availability and labor costs.
The ideal window for roofing in Streeter is between late May and early October, when temperatures are reliably above freezing for proper shingle sealing and adhesive activation. A typical replacement takes 2-4 days for a professional crew, but this is highly weather-dependent. We advise scheduling a consultation early in the spring to secure a spot, as reputable local contractors book up quickly for the short summer season.
Always verify the contractor is licensed and insured to work in North Dakota and carries ample workers' compensation. Choose a provider with extensive local experience who can show examples of work withstanding Streeter's specific weather. They should provide a detailed, written estimate and be knowledgeable about local building codes, which may include specific requirements for wind resistance and snow load capacity for our area.
